Baconers Sell To £4 6/9 At Kamo Sale

Late Commercial I

Walter Wakelin reports having held a succesful sale of cattle and pigs at Kamo yesterday, when a medium entry of cattle and a large entry of pigs was submitted to a large attendance of buyers. Cattle sold_ well, as di'd fat pigs, baconers selfing to £4 6/9. Stores and, weaners were hard to quit, prices being the lowest for a long time. Fat cows sold f/om £5 10/ to £8 5/; medium fat cows, £4 to £5; fat Jersey cows, £3 10/ to £5 5/; heavy bener cows, £3 1/ to £3 15/; medium boner cows, £2 10/ to £3; light boner and potter cows, £1 to £2; cows and calves, £2 12/6 to £5 2/6; good quality yearling Jersey, heifers, £3 10/ to £4; yearling crossbred heifers, to £2 5/; mixed sex Shorthorn calves, £1 15/; Jersey heifer calves, £1 10/ to £2 5/; Shorthorn store cows, £3 5/ 1o £4 4/; dairy cows, close to profit, £5 1.0/ to £8; springing heifers, to £.5 10; cows in milk, to £6 10/; twotool ii wethers, 17/10.

i-igs,—Heavy baconers sold from £•1 0/9 to £4 t>/9; medium baconers, £3 13 ro £4; heavy porkers, £2 10/ to £2 16/; medium porkers, £1 18/ to £2 4/; light porkers, £1 18/ to £2; large stores, £1 5/ to £1 15/; slips, 15/ to £1 3/; weaners, 2/ to 15/; breeding sows, to £2; choppers, £2 to £4 10/.
